Grafic Card Dell E521

I wanted to upgrade my Dell E521 grafic card, but i am wurried it will not work, this is the problem, i noticed that my monitor always has been plugged in to the onboard slot and never in the card that plugged in the PCI express slot, if i put the monitor in the other slot i have a black screen. I looked in the bios where i see that the PCI express slot is empty but there is a card in it.  If i put an other grafic card in it i see the fan on the card running but still the PCI slot is empty when looking in the bios. The onboard grafic card has to turn off when detecting an other card but this is not working. At Dell the sad to flip the little batery for 10 seconds but this did not work. I already bought a card (gefore 9600 GT) and i know i have to upgrade my PSU for it to make it work, but before i gonna spend more money i want to solve this problem.

    It sound like the PCIe slot is not working which would mean you would need a new motherboard. If you have plugged two different cards in and you see now video that is what is leading me. You should at least see the Dell Splash screen at boot up are you seeing that?

    Have you tried to boot into Safemode to see if you have video there. Even with installing the card drivers widows will load generic vga drivers to allow basic video display. If it will not work even in safe mode with both of the cards then there is an issue with the PCIe slot.

    Make sure that you are fully inserting the cards into the slot. some of them go in a bit firm.

    Make sure your Primary video setting in the bios is set to AUTO
